As the healthcare industry continues to grow so does the need for workers in administrative and clinical environments who understand the fundamentals of patient care. Healthcare Fundamentals is a course that provides a professional understanding of patient care in a variety of healthcare settings. The course focuses on the theory, principles and methods to provide quality improvement and etiquette when delivering healthcare services. A particular focus is on the application of these methods in both clinical and administrative environments.
